Description
Defra is seeking an experienced supplier familiar with ecosystem approaches to fisheries management, to
deliver evidence and best practice guidance based on international case studies. This research will support
implementation of Target 5 of the Convention on Biological Diversity (CBD) Kunming-Montreal Global
Biodiversity Framework (KMGBF), as well as considering outcomes relevant for other elements of the KMGBF
(e.g., Targets 9 and 10).
The project will be delivered in two phases with the aim of:
• Increasing our understanding of where and how ecosystem approaches are being utilised in fisheries
management globally (focussing on commercial wild capture fisheries).
• Exploring what has and has not worked, to produce best practice recommendations that could help
to guide effective implementation of Targets 5*, 9** and 10*** of the Kunming-Montreal Global
Biodiversity Framework (GBF).
This project was awarded by DEFRA.
